EBay Founder Tweets About an Unusual Lawsuit

Fri, Feb 20th, 2009

Leave it to Twitter, the microblogging service, to persuade a stubbornly private billionaire to chronicle his daily activities in short, 140-character bursts.

That is what has happened to Pierre Omidyar, the eBay founder, philanthropist and start-up investor. For more than a decade he has mostly preferred to stay below the public radar, but for the last two years he has been happily Twittering his life at twitter.com/pierre.

In between the predictable details of mundane life as a very wealthy man – video games with his family, flip-flopping on whether to grow a beard – Mr. Omidyar has divulged that he is being sued by a former employee.

“Ok, now I’ve seen everything,” Mr. Omidyar wrote earlier this week. “I’m being sued by someone who claims I’ve been palling around with terrorists.”
